Religion: Today we began chapter 25 in Jonathan’s We Believe textbook. This lesson is entitled, We Honor Mary and the Saints. We read about how Mary is the mother of Jesus. We discussed things that Jonathan’s mother does for him and then read about things Mary did. We also read about how the Church honors Mary and Jonathan read the Hail Mary prayer. Language Arts: In his iReady textbook, we used a fiction source text to look at the story words and pictures. We examined what the text said the character felt and then what the picture showed about the character’s feelings. Then, using a nonfiction text source, we looked at what the words specifically said about a key detail and then found the key information being presented in the caption. To continue our study of nonfiction text features, we watched a fun video on You Tube that used a cartoon drawing style to present the text features. Jonathan read a paragraph and answered questions for a text feature activity that focused on maps. Jonathan then drew a map of his home and neighborhood for his All About Me project. We also labeled a diagram and he drew a picture of this family and labeled it for his project as we will utilize the text features of map, diagram, and chart. For literature today, we first watched a Brain Pop Jr. learning video on compare and contrast. Jonathan scored 4/5 on both the easy and hard follow-up quizzes. Next, we read chapter 4 in our novel, Pirates Past Dawn. After our reading, we exercised the literary skill of compare and contrast between the two characters, Jack and Cap’n Bones. Additionally, we read chapter 5 and Jonathan then illustrated and used a few words to describe the beginning, middle, and end of the chapter. Jonathan also practiced his book-specific spelling words.
